ETF Overview

Materials Select Sector SPDR Fund (the Fund) seeks to provide invest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ance of the Materials Select Sector Index (the Index). The Index includes companies involved in such industries as chemicals; metals and mining; paper and forest products; containers and packaging, and construction materials. The Fund's investment advisor is SSgA Funds Management, Inc.

Materials Select Sector SPDR Fund shares split before market open on Friday, December 5th 2025.A 2-1 split was announced. The newly issued shares were issued to shareholders after the market closes on Thursday, December 4th 2025. An investor that had 100 shares of stock prior to the split would have 200 shares after the split.
